How many Ferrari F430 Spiders were made?
Total production numbers are rough, however approximately 14,000 F430 and F430 Spiders were made, with a further production of ~2,000 Scuderias and 499 16Ms. The car boasts Ferrari’s F136 E engine with variants used in the 458 Italia as well as in 4.2L & 4.7L applications for Maserati.

How much is a 1990 Ferrari?
The only major change came in the pricing department, as the cost of entry soared from about $85,000 in 1985 to nearly $150,000 by 1990. After more than 7,000 cars had been built, production concluded at the end of 1991, and the Testarossa gave way to the 512 TR.

What is the Ferrari worth in Ferris Bueller?
The Ferrari 250 GT California Spyder replica famed for its role in Ferris Bueller’s Day Off goes under the hammer. A fake Ferrari famously used in iconic 1980s movie Ferris Bueller’s Day Off, has sold for a staggering US$396,000 (A$577,000) at auction last weekend.
